1. BLUF (Bottom Line Up Front)

Cisco and Wiz have announced a strategic collaboration aimed at enhancing cloud security in response to the increasing threats posed by AI-driven tools. This partnership leverages Cisco’s network security capabilities and Wiz’s cloud security innovation to address vulnerabilities in complex IT infrastructures. The collaboration is expected to improve the ability of enterprises to rapidly identify and mitigate risks, thereby strengthening their defense against emerging threats.
